INTRODUCTION: Catheter ablation has become a well-established therapy for isthmus-dependent right atrial flutter (AFL). Recently, mapping and ablation of AFL have been performed using sophisticated three-dimensional mapping systems, such as electroanatomic and noncontact mapping systems. The LocaLisa system enables nonfluoroscopic navigation of intracardiac electrode catheters based on impedance changes related to catheter movements in transthoracic current fields. The aim of this randomized prospective study was to compare the efficacy of the LocaLisa system with the conventional mapping/ablation approach for radiofrequency ablation of AFL. METHODS AND RESULTS: Fifty consecutive patients with AFL (39 men and 11 women; age 65 +/- 10 years) were studied. The patients were randomly assigned to undergo radiofrequency ablation guided by a conventional fluoroscopy-based approach (24 patients) or by the LocaLisa system (26 patients). Ablation success rate and documentation of bidirectional isthmus block were 100% in both groups. Compared with fluoroscopy-guided approaches, LocaLisa-guided procedures demonstrated a reduction in total fluoroscopy time from 15.9 +/- 10.6 minutes to 7.5 +/- 6.5 minutes (P < 0.005). Total fluoroscopy dosage was reduced from 21.0 +/- 19.8 to 8.7 +/- 9.5 Gycm2 (P < 0.05). Fluoroscopy time required for ablation was significantly shortened in the LocaLisa group (2.6 +/- 2.6 min) compared with the conventional approach group (11 +/- 10 min, P < 0.0005). In 9 (35%) of 26 patients, the ablation could be performed with a fluoroscopy time < or = 1 minute. There were no significant differences with regard to the number of radiofrequency applications, fluoroscopy time needed for diagnostic reasons, total procedure time, or other ablation data. CONCLUSION: Compared with the conventional approach, the LocaLisa system significantly reduces the fluoroscopy times needed for ablation of typical AFL.  相似文献

The environmental impact of chromated copper arsenate (CCA)-treated utility poles is linked to the possible soil and groundwater contamination with arsenic. The objective of the present study was to determine the arsenic speciation in soil and groundwater near in-service CCA-treated poles. Arsenite (As[III]) and arsenate (As[V]) concentrations were determined in 29 surface and subsurface soil samples collected near eight CCA-treated wood poles. Temporal variability of total arsenic concentrations and inorganic arsenic speciation was also assessed in groundwater at two sites through four sampling events over a 19-month period. Arsenic speciation was carried out by a solvent extraction method using ammonium pyrrolidine dithiocarbamate-methyl isobutyl ketone, and total arsenic was quantified by inductively coupled plasma/atomic emission spectrometry/hydride generation. Average arsenic concentrations in surface soils immediately adjacent to utility poles ranged from 153+/-49 to 410+/-150 mg/kg but approached background levels (below 5 mg/kg) within 0.50 m from the poles. A positive correlation was found between surface soil As concentration and total Fe content. In subsurface samples (0.50 m), arsenic levels were generally high in sandy soils (up to 223+/-32 mg/kg), moderate in clayey soils (up to 126+/-26 mg/kg), and relatively lower in organic soils (up to 56+/-24 mg/ kg). Arsenic(V) was the predominant arsenic species in surface (>78%) and subsurface soils (>66%). Total arsenic concentrations in groundwater below the clayey site were high and varied widely over time (79-390 microg/L), with 30 to 68% as As(III). Below the utility pole located on the organic site with a high Fe content, lower total arsenic levels (12-33 microg/L) were found, with As(III) ranging from 0 to 100%.  相似文献

Background

The identification of psychological risk factors is important for the selection of patients before spinal surgery. Moreover, the effect of surgical decompression in lumbar spinal stenosis (LSS) on psychological outcome is not previously well analyzed.

Aim of paper

to investigate clinical and psychological outcome after surgery for LSS and the effect of depressive symptoms and anxiety on the clinical outcome.

Materials and methods

A total of 25 patients with symptomatic LSS underwent decompressive surgery with or without spinal stabilization were prospectively enrolled in this observational surgery. The Symptom Checklist-90-Revised (SCL-90-R) was used to assess global psychological distress with a summary score termed Global Severity Index (GSI) and single psychological disorders including depression (DEP) and anxiety (ANX). The clinical outcome of surgery was evaluated with the Oswestry Disability Index (ODI) and visual analogue scale (VAS) pain assessment.

Results

Compared with baseline, there was a statistically significant improvement in VAS, ODI and GSI after surgery (p < 0.05) in all patients. Univariate analysis revealed that patients with high GSI and anxiety and depression scores had significantly higher ODI and VAS scores in the follow-up with a bad outcome.

Conclusions

Surgery for spinal stenosis was effective to treat pain and disability. In this prospective study baseline global psychological distress, depression and anxiety were associated with poorer clinical outcome.  相似文献

OBJECTIVE: The aim of this study was to evaluate if administration of adenosine during sinus rhythm to patients with PSVT of unknown mechanism is capable to detect dual AV nodal conduction and furthermore to evaluate this diagnostic parameter as a controlling test after slow pathway ablation in AVNRT. METHODS AND RESULTS: Before electrophysiological study 35 consecutive patients with PSVT were given adenosine during sinus rhythm. After radiofrequency ablation the adenosine test was repeated in a subset of 19 patients. The electrophysiological study revealed 19 patients (54%) with typical AVNRT (study group), 10 (29%) with atrioventricular reentry tachycardia (AVRT), 4 (11%) with ectopic atrial tachycardia (EAT) and 2 patients (6%) with inducible atrial flutter (AF) (control group). We observed a sudden increment of the PQ interval of more than 50 msec between two consecutive beats in 15 of 19 patients (79%) in the study group (75+/-35 msec) and in 2 patients (1 with EAT, AF) of the control group (19+/-12 msec) (p<0.001). After slow pathway radiofrequency ablation the sudden increment of PQ interval persisted in 4 of 12 patients (33%) of the study group. Three of these 4 patients had a relapse of AVNRT during a follow-up of 3 months. CONCLUSION: The administration of adenosine during sinus rhythm is an excellent noninvasive diagnostic test for identifying dual AV nodal conduction and additionally for verifying radiofrequency ablation results in patients with AVNRT.  相似文献
